What is the 4D strategy regarding the counterterrorism policy?
The first tenet of the 4D strategy (Defeat, Deny, Diminish and Defend) calls for defeating terrorist organizations of global reach through the direct or indirect use of diplomatic, economic, information, law enforcement, military, financial, intelligence, and other instruments of power.
What is the aim of the Prevent strategy?
The aim of the Prevent strategy is to reduce the threat to the UK from terrorism by stopping people becoming terrorists or supporting terrorism. In the Act this has simply been expressed as the need to “prevent people from being drawn into terrorism”.
What is the prepare strategy?
The Prepare strategy aims to mitigate the impact of a terrorist attack that cannot be stopped. This work includes bringing a terrorist attack to an end and increased resilience in order to recover after an attack.

Which strategy aims to reduce the threat to the UK from terrorism Prevent prepare prevail performance?
CONTEST is the UK’s counter terrorism strategy. It aims to reduce the risks from terrorism, so that people can go about their lives freely and with confidence. CONTEST has 4 strands: Prevent: to stop people becoming terrorists or supporting terrorism.
